HUGO LLORIS will sign a new contract at Tottenham BEFORE Euro 2016, according to reports.
Spurs want France star Hugo Lloris to sign a new contract before Euro 2016
Goalkeeper Lloris, 29, is tipped to be given a fresh deal at Spurs after a stellar season between the sticks.
The club are said to be wary of Manchester United's interest in their star man and want to reward him for his loyalty to the club.
That is according to the Daily Mirror, who claim Lloris will be offered a five-year contract at White Hart Lane.

Spurs are determined to kick on from a successful campaign that has seen them challenge for the Premier League title by locking down their star men to long-term deals.
Kyle Walker, Jan Vertonghen, Danny Rose and Christian Eriksen could all reportedly land fresh terms during the summer.
And manager Mauricio Pochettino himself is ready to sign a new five-year contract at the north London club as he prepares his squad for domestic and European football next season.
